Fix setting FdFile::ReadOnlyMode() flag

The Unix flag O_RDONLY is defined as zero and hence its presence
cannot be tested with '(flags & O_RDONLY) != 0'. This used to be
broken in FdFlag when setting its internal `read_only_mode_` flag.

Test: m test-art-host-gtest-fd_file_test

diff --git a/runtime/base/unix_file/fd_file.cc b/runtime/base/unix_file/fd_file.cc
index 6f0e125..48e3ceb 100644
--- a/runtime/base/unix_file/fd_file.cc
+++ b/runtime/base/unix_file/fd_file.cc
@@ -132,14 +132,14 @@
 }
 
 bool FdFile::Open(const std::string& path, int flags, mode_t mode) {
+  static_assert(O_RDONLY == 0, "Readonly flag has unexpected value.");
   CHECK_EQ(fd_, -1) << path;
-  read_only_mode_ = (flags & O_RDONLY) != 0;
+  read_only_mode_ = ((flags & O_ACCMODE) == O_RDONLY);
   fd_ = TEMP_FAILURE_RETRY(open(path.c_str(), flags, mode));
   if (fd_ == -1) {
     return false;
   }
   file_path_ = path;
-  static_assert(O_RDONLY == 0, "Readonly flag has unexpected value.");
   if (kCheckSafeUsage && (flags & (O_RDWR | O_CREAT | O_WRONLY)) != 0) {
     // Start in the base state (not flushed, not closed).
     guard_state_ = GuardState::kBase;
